Competitive landscape

Real competitors

Not just names — pricing bands, strengths, weaknesses, funding stage, and who they sell to.

Epic Systems

Public player
Pricing
Enterprise EHR contracts (multi-million typical)
Funding stage
Private
Target audience
Health systems and hospitals
Strengths
  • Hospital system of record
  • Deep clinical workflows
Weaknesses
  • Closed ecosystem
  • Brutal sales cycles for outsiders

Teladoc / virtual care platforms

Public player
Pricing
B2B employer contracts + visit fees
Funding stage
Public (NYSE: TDOC)
Target audience
Employers, health plans, patients
Strengths
  • Brand in telehealth
  • Network effects of providers
Weaknesses
  • Margin pressure
  • Utilization variability

Point solutions (RPM, scheduling, RCM)

Market archetype
Pricing
Per-provider or per-claim SaaS, often $100s–$1000s/mo
Funding stage
Seed–Series C common
Target audience
Clinics and specialty practices
Strengths
  • Faster sales than full EHR
  • Clear ROI stories
Weaknesses
  • Integration tax
  • Hospital IT prioritization
